Recipe for Sorrel Soup

No Reviews
AuthorCategoryDifficultyBeginner

A little tangy flavor that stimulates the taste buds and makes you forget the khaki color of this soup... The sorrel is delicious!

Yields4 Servings
Prep Time5 minsCook Time15 minsTotal Time20 mins
Ingredients
 200 Sorrel
 1 Water
 2 Onion
 20 Butter
 1 clove Garlic
 20 Sour cream
 Pepper
 Salt
 Freshly grated nutmeg
Directions
1

Thoroughly wash the sorrel and drain it, removing the stems to keep only the leaves. Slice the onion and garlic.

2

Melt 20 g of butter in a pot, sauté the sliced onions and garlic over low heat. Add the spinach and sorrel; wilt them over low heat, then add the broth. Cook for about 15 minutes.

3

Blend finely, add the cream (or the cream-milk mixture), pepper and salt to taste, a little grated nutmeg.

4

To finish, serve hot or chilled depending on the season.
